This definitely isn't the right thread for this but I know a lot of us here fuck with house/dance/electronic shit.

Is there anyone doing that classic house sound right now? I'm talking diva samples, piano chords, 90s vibes, etc. You know what I mean. Bicep Vision of Love shit. That LP I posted is definitely fucking with that vibe.

Seems like in the house world "lo fi" house kinda took over which is a much hazier thing. I love it for sure, but the former is my favorite shit and it's a little out of favor at the moment it seems. I loooove people like DJ Seinfeld, Ross From Friends, Mall Grab (the first two especially have evolved so much), do I'm definitely not shitting on that movement.

Shit like Bicep (who cycle through tons of sounds but at one point mastered that vibe), Krystal Klear, Ejeca, Scuba (only dabbled in it) , Citizenn (sorta), Cream Soda (godly first album, declined hard afterwards.... godawful third album), Head High (sorta), etc etc etc


I feel like I'm fairly informed but I can't find much of it at the moment. A lot of those artists have kinda moved away from it and it bums me out.

Definitely check out the latest Octo Octa album as well as her work/B2B mixes with Eris Drew. Some of Paul Woolford/Special Request's stuff is straight up house too, Bedroom Tapes and Offworld from last year iirc.

I also always stan Omar-S. He's just a constant banger machine
